What is the proper and cleanest way to rename an Enterprise Miner Project?

I will admit that I have gotten sloppy in the past renaming things in Windows and paying the price later.

The reason is simply because I titled my newest project "Test1-" not thinking it was going anywhere. But now I wish to make this my project of focus for my office.

Thank you very much.

**************************************

As a follow-up- I tried to rename it within the SAS Management Console. Specifically within the Application Management directory, and within there the Projects. I renamed it from Test1 to Test2. Then I went into Enterprise Miner and clicked on Recent Projects. It did not see Test 2, but it saw Test 1. If I try to open it then it says it cannot find the files - do I want to remove the directory. Of course I said no. Then I tried opening a new Project. Here it found Test2, but when I tried to open it I got a similar message saying the files were not found.

So I am sort of back to square one. Any thoughts and/or suggestions are welcome.
